Okay, most of you guys know about the ever-so-popular blind bags, wave one just being released in the US.
Everyone remember how to figure out what's in the bag? You just lift the flap on the back of the bag, read the number, and match it to the pony's trading card.
I've been to three walmarts this week and two Toys R Us's and none of the blind bags there have numbers on them anymore. None. Of. Them. I am positive I'm looking in the right place, as I've got the entire set by using the numbering system.
Is this happening anywhere else?
I mean, I don't mind buying duplicates of the blind bags, but when Wave 2 comes I'm afraid I'll have to spend tons of money just to find a few of my favorites, lol.

What Taxel said. If you're looking for numbers 1 through 24, they don't use those anymore. They have new numbers.

Example of what I'm talking about: Rainbow Dash is #3, but she is also #20435. I found my blind bag ponies using the larger number, the smaller number is no longer on the bags, just the complicated one, and it can be hard to read as its "stamped" onto the bag.

I can give you a list of all the numbers and the ponies they go to.

I've noticed the problem with the numbers on packages, too. What I've also noticed is that there is a small pinhole at the top of each package so if you shake the package just right, you may be able to make out the hair/coat colors, or even feel what shape the pony is, and whether she's got a horn or wings or not.
